Capcom Plans To Revive Some Of Its Franchises

Marvel vs. Capcom Infinite is just the first step in the Japanese company’s „regeneration.”

According to ShackNews, Capcom is starting to begin focusing on those franchises that did not get a new title in the recent years. They were listed in their press release. There are quite a few – let’s see the list.

Mega Man, Mega Man X, Dino Crisis, Lost Planet, Onimusha, Ghosts ‘N Goblins, Final Fight, Breath of Fire. Huh, there are some names on the list that launched as early as the eighties, nineties. There are platformers, beat’em ups and even RPGs.

Capcom‘s thoughts have potential, but they have to make new games, too, not just re-release the old ones with not a lot of work done on them.
